2015 (4) TMI 1076 - HC - CustomsValidity of acquittal order - Recovered 3 gold bars in raid - Also statements of the respondents also recorded under Section 108 of the Customs Act, 1962 - Held that:- at the time of passing the impugned judgment, learned trial Judge has given categorical finding that there are some contradictions in the evidence as regards the packing of the sample. It is also found that from the report it cannot be said that it is of the sample taken in the present case and even the panch witness is also not supporting the case of the prosecution. Therefore, the learned trial Judge has rightly observed that from the evidence on record it could not be proved that offence as alleged against the respondents-accused could not be established. Therefore, the learned Judge has rightly observed that the prosecution could not prove its case beyond reasonable doubt and rightly acquitted the accused of the charges levelled against them. - Decided against the appellant
